A non-profit organization supporting people with disabilities needed better control over its network across 12 locations in Berlin, managed by a small IT team serving around 1,600 employees. The existing infrastructure relied on different VPN solutions, a heterogeneous server landscape, and limited bandwidth, making monitoring and troubleshooting difficult. Configuration changes were complex and faults were not detected quickly enough. To address these challenges, the organization sought a modern, easy-to-use network management solution. By adopting Cisco Meraki for centralized network control, the IT team gained full visibility, simplified configuration, faster fault detection, and improved bandwidth efficiency, enabling more reliable and manageable network operations.
